Founded in 1964, the Peralta Community College District (PCCD) is a collaborative community of colleges comprised of Berkeley City College, College of Alameda, and Laney and Merritt colleges in Oakland, Calif. The Peralta Colleges provide a dynamic multicultural learning environment offering accessible, high-quality educational programs and services, including two-year degrees, certificates and university transfer programs, to more than 30,000 students. PCCD is home to award-winning Peralta TV (Comcast ch. 27/28, AT&T ch. 99) and public radio KGPC-LP 96.9 FM.
Berkeley City College, one of California?s 113 community colleges, is located at 2050 Center St. between Shattuck Ave. & Milvia Sts. in downtown Berkeley, in one of the world?s great education centers. As it meets the demands of urban education in the 21st century, Berkeley City College continues to offer programs and classes which transfer to U.C. Berkeley, the California State Universities and to private colleges. The college also offers model occupational training programs in American Sign Language, biotechnology, multimedia arts, the sciences, global education, business and information technology.
College of Alameda is a small, friendly community college noted for the excellence of its academic, vocational and student support programs. Situated on a beautiful park-like campus on the island city of Alameda, the College offers the quiet of a suburban setting, just minutes from downtown Oakland.
Laney College is the largest of the four Peralta Community College District campuses, serving approximately 12,000 students annually. As the flagship college for the Peralta District, Laney College stretches across sixty acres in downtown Oakland, California, one of the most ethnically and economically diverse cities in America. Laney is also one of the oldest community colleges in the nation, celebrating 65 years in 2018. Laney College offers associate degrees in more than 20 liberal arts and science fields, a significant number of graduates go on to attend 4-year colleges and universities, including the University of California and California State University systems.
Merritt College opened its doors nearly 60 years ago and today remains the heart of a thriving, diverse community where students of all ages and backgrounds can get a quality education at a very affordable price. As a community college, Merritt provides college-level education at a fraction of the cost of four-year or Private University. Merritt offers a wide array of certificates, associate degrees, and transfer courses that you can choose from to design a career. Some of the most sought-after programs are nursing, radiology, nutrition, microscopy, administration of justice, child development, paralegal studies, and much more.
The Peralta Colleges? student population mirrors the ethnic diversity of the San Francisco Bay Area. Students come from all over the world and bring with them diverse cultural backgrounds, worldviews, learning and sharing their dreams and aspirations.
